
Seventy-five percent of health IT professionals surveyed believe that less than 25% of hospitals will be prepared to meet all of the metrics of "meaningful use" of electronic health records by the beginning of fiscal year 2011, according to a survey by the Healthcare Information and Management Systems Society.
Twenty percent of respondents indicated that 25% to 49% of hospitals will be able to meet all meaningful use metrics by FY 2011, while 4% said they believed that 50% to 74% of hospitals will be ready to meet all meaningful use metrics.
None of the respondents thought that 75% or more of U.S. hospitals would be ready to meet all metrics for meaningful use of EHRs by FY 2011.
Results are based on a May 2009 online survey of 184 health IT professionals.
